someConfig

java 代码
  1. </bean id="baseSqlMapClient" scope="singleton"  
  2.     class="org.springframework.orm.ibatis.SqlMapClientFactoryBean">   
  3.     <property name="configLocation">   
  4.         <value>classpath:conf/ibatis/sql-map-config-all.xml</value>   
  5.     </property>   
  6. </bean>   
  7. </bean id="baseSqlMapClientTemplate" scope="singleton"  
  8.     class="org.springframework.orm.ibatis.SqlMapClientTemplate">   
  9.     <property name="sqlMapClient" ref="baseSqlMapClient" />   
  10.     <property name="dataSource" ref="dataSource" />   
  11. </bean>   
  12. </bean id="baseDaoAbstractDefination" abstract="true" scope="singleton"  
  13.     class="org.springframework.orm.ibatis.support.SqlMapClientDaoSupport">   
  14.     <property name="sqlMapClientTemplate" ref="baseSqlMapClientTemplate" />   
  15. <//bean>   
  16. </bean id="XXXXXXXXXXXXXDAO" parent="baseDaoAbstractDefination" class="XXX.XXX.XXXDAOImpl"/>  

  <property name="sqlMapClientTemplate" ref="baseSqlMapClientTemplate"></property>

<bean class="XXX.XXX.XXXDAOImpl" id="XXXXXXXXXXXXXDAO" parent="baseDaoAbstractDefination"></bean>
  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
/** * Perform the specified type of NV config reset. The radio will be taken offline * and the device must be rebooted after the operation. Used for device * configuration by some CDMA operators. * * <p>Requires Permission: * {@link android.Manifest.permission#MODIFY_PHONE_STATE MODIFY_PHONE_STATE} or that the calling * app has carrier privileges (see {@link #hasCarrierPrivileges}). * * TODO: remove this one. use {@link #rebootRadio()} for reset type 1 and * {@link #resetRadioConfig()} for reset type 3 * * @param resetType reset type: 1: reload NV reset, 2: erase NV reset, 3: factory NV reset * @return true on success; false on any failure. * * @hide */ @UnsupportedAppUsage public boolean nvResetConfig(int resetType) { try { ITelephony telephony = getITelephony(); if (telephony != null) { if (resetType == 1 /*1: reload NV reset */) { return telephony.rebootModem(getSlotIndex()); } else if (resetType == 3 /3: factory NV reset /) { return telephony.resetModemConfig(getSlotIndex()); } else { Rlog.e(TAG, "nvResetConfig unsupported reset type"); } } } catch (RemoteException ex) { Rlog.e(TAG, "nvResetConfig RemoteException", ex); } catch (NullPointerException ex) { Rlog.e(TAG, "nvResetConfig NPE", ex); } return false; } / * Rollback modem configurations to factory default except some config which are in whitelist. * Used for device configuration by some carriers. * * <p>Requires Permission: * {@link android.Manifest.permission#MODIFY_PHONE_STATE MODIFY_PHONE_STATE} or that the calling * app has carrier privileges (see {@link #hasCarrierPrivileges}). * * @return {@code true} on success; {@code false} on any failure. * * @hide */ @RequiresPermission(Manifest.permission.MODIFY_PHONE_STATE) @SystemApi public boolean resetRadioConfig() { try { ITelephony telephony = getITelephony(); if (telephony != null) { return telephony.resetModemConfig(getSlotIndex()); } } catch (RemoteException ex) { Rlog.e(TAG, "resetRadioConfig RemoteException", ex); } catch (NullPointerException ex) { Rlog.e(TAG, "resetRadioConfig NPE", ex); } return false; }这两个接口是否可以恢复相关的网络
07-14
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值